if you pay child support and health insurance for a child can your tax refund be taken if you owe back monies

If you owe back child support, yes it can be taken evan if you are currently paying.
6 :
Yes and if you are married they can take your spouses refund as well if you filed together. So the spouse needs to notify the irs that they are not the one who owes. There is a form for that. While you are paying child support payments regularly then you can also pay so much toward the arrears. You will need to notify the child support enforcement or courts so it gets documented correctly.
